Abstract
The utility model belongs to water-treatment technology field, in particular a kind of cultivation bioceramic water activating device, including cabinet, first servo motor is fixedly installed in the bottom interior wall of the cabinet, fixing sleeve is equipped with the first belt pulley on the output shaft of the first servo motor, first supporting block there are two being fixedly mounted in the bottom interior wall of the cabinet, same first screw rod is rotatably equipped in two the first supporting blocks, fixing sleeve is equipped with the second belt pulley on first screw rod, and second is wound with same first belt between belt pulley and the first belt pulley jointly, there are two the first sliding blocks for screw thread installation on first screw rod, hinge bar has been respectively articulated on two the first sliding blocks, the top of two hinge bars has been respectively articulated with the second supporting block, the bottom of two the second supporting blocks is fixedly installed with same first support plate, first support plate Top be equipped with multiple protective shells.The utility model practicability is high, convenient disassembly, and it is convenient to clear up.

Background technique
Bioceramic refers to a kind of ceramic material for being used as specific biology or physiological function, that is, be directly used in human body or with
The ceramic material of directly related biological, the medical, biochemistry of human body etc. needs to have following item as bioceramic material
Part: biocompatibility, mechanical compatibility have an excellent compatibility with biological tissue, antithrombotic, sterilising and have good object
Reason, chemical stability, can be very good to apply in the water body running water of aquaculture, and animal immunizing power can be improved, and eliminate poultry
Stench is given up, poultry environment is purified.
But the water consumption of aquaculture is larger, the time has been grown to need to clear up Ceramic Balls container later, and existing
Aquaculture Ceramic Balls container, disassembly is inconvenient, clears up inconvenient.
Therefore we have proposed a kind of cultivation bioceramic water activating devices for solving the above problems.
